Discover Launceston from The Fenway Hostel, a welcoming, heritage-style hostel just minutes from the heart of the city. The Fenway offers a range of bed types to suit all travellers: Custom timber pods, bunk dorms, female dorms and private queen rooms.

Set within one of Launceston’s grand historic buildings, The Fenway offers clean, comfortable and great-value accommodation for travellers who want an easy, reliable stay with a friendly atmosphere. Whether you’re travelling solo or with friends, it’s a relaxed base to explore Northern Tasmania and connect with fellow travellers along the way.

The Fenway is located in Invermay, just a short walk from the Launceston CBD, with cafés, restaurants and local shops nearby. Many of Launceston’s most popular sights are within easy walking distance, making it simple to explore without a car.

Launceston is also an ideal base for day trips around Northern Tasmania:
- Tamar Valley wineries – 20 minutes
- Ben Lomond National Park – 1 hr 15 min
- Cradle Mountain – 2 hrs
- Freycinet National Park – 2 hrs
- Hobart – 2 hrs
- Spirit of Tasmania ferry terminal – 1 hr 10 min
